Transaction 677dbd55a22f40f28f85735d2a202ae1e23677181bf6949ad5bdb1ac8f00fa0c
1 Input
1 Output
-
677dbd55a22f40f28f85735d2a202ae1e23677181bf6949ad5bdb1ac8f00fa0c:0
- value
- 2288668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8df3f0ba8c3ea8b75791ded2712e39a628897926 OP_EQUAL
- address
- 3EdbRs5cnH6tYfqN2smUpS9KBpziNejZYY